Where Do Your Kids Go?

Children kindergarten and older worship with their families at 8:05 and 10:30 services. All kids are welcome in worship and invited to the front of the room for a special kids’ message each Sunday. Find worship supplements like kids’ activity bulletins and fidget bags outside the worship space. Kids with sensory needs who are overwhelmed in a large worship space may visit Room 212 with a parent and view the service from there. Babies through pre-kindergartners are cared for in our secure Kids’ Area during worship.

At 9:15, Bible Study is provided for all children, birth through 6th grade, in 2nd floor classrooms. To get your security tags, please check in at kiosks inside Entrance 4.  Students in 7th grade and above join our Student Ministry in the Student Center for Bible Study at 9:15. All volunteers working with children (birth–18) complete background checks with local and national registries and are trained in best practices by qualified leaders.

What Should You Wear?

In the early (contemporary-style) service which meets in our Life Center, you will find most people dressed in anything from business-casual to jeans and T-shirts. In the later (traditional-style) service that meets in our sanctuary, you will find most people dressed in business-casual or jackets and ties for men and slacks or dresses for women.

However, we have no “dress code,” so feel free to come as you are!
